Saccharide Hydrolysate is a sugar-based humectant that helps bind water in the skin and support moisture levels. It is mild and generally well tolerated, though composition varies by source and needs preservation.

Function

HUMECTANT

Skin benefits

  • Provides humectant and skin-conditioning effects
  • Sugar-derived and generally well tolerated
  • Supports skin moisture retention
  • Compatible with most formulation systems

Known concerns

  • Composition can vary by source carbohydrate and hydrolysis method
  • Microbial contamination risk requires preservation
  • Limited specific clinical efficacy data
  • Stickiness can affect skin feel at high use levels
